To Whom It May Concern.
I am a 61-year-old disabled man on a fixed income living in Baltimore. I have osteoporosis, a history of End Stage Renal Disease (ESRD), mental illness, and I am visually impaired in one eye. My power was cut off by BGE on 5/17/24. I was referred to local churches and charities by Community Action Council (CAC) for donations to have my power restored. Unfortunately, the total amount that’s owed is about $1,600 for me to have my power restored, but I have raised only $600. I am still $1,000 short of what I need just to turn my power back on.
I tried the Department of Social Services, but they only offer utility assistance to people with children, which I don’t have. They could only refer me to OHEP and EUSP which sent me back to CAC where they already told me I wasn’t eligible and there is nothing else they can do after referring me to multiple resources. I also contacted the Fuel Fund of Maryland, but I need to get a re-estimate because the one-week exportation date has passed. I must refile, but I cannot get through whether I re-apply or try to call. I also stated the matter to the social administrator where I seek my medical care, but there was nothing they could do because I have no medical equipment in the home.
I only depend on SSDI as my sole source of income to live in Baltimore. I have absolutely no idea where else to turn to pay the remainder of this bill and restore my service.
